1. Source Code Management Tools

A foundational aspect of DevOps is managing source code effectively. Git-based systems like GitHub, GitLab, and Bitbucket are indispensable.

  • GitHub: Offers collaborative coding with integrated pull requests and code reviews.
  • GitLab: Provides a full DevOps platform, covering from SCM to CI/CD pipelines.
  • Bitbucket: Integrates well with Jira, making it a favorite among many agile teams.

2. Continuous Integration and Continuous Deployment (CI/CD)

CI/CD pipelines automate the testing and deployment of code, ensuring that mobile apps are always in a deployable state.

  • Jenkins: Open-source and highly customizable for setting up automated build pipelines.
  • CircleCI: Known for speed and powerful integrations with GitHub and Bitbucket.
  • Bitrise: Specifically designed for mobile app CI/CD, supporting iOS, Android, and Flutter projects.

3. Configuration Management Tools

Configuration management allows you to automate the setup and maintenance of your infrastructure, ensuring consistency.

  • Ansible: Simple yet powerful, with a minimal learning curve.
  • Chef: Offers robust infrastructure automation capabilities.
  • Puppet: Ideal for managing complex deployments with intricate dependencies.

4. Monitoring and Analytics

Proactive monitoring of mobile apps post-deployment helps in identifying issues before they affect users.

  • New Relic: Monitors app performance, infrastructure, and user interactions.
  • Datadog: Combines monitoring, security, and analytics into a single platform.
  • Firebase Performance Monitoring: Especially useful for mobile apps, offering insights into network requests and app startup times.

5. Automated Testing Tools

Testing is an essential part of DevOps to catch bugs early and ensure a stable mobile experience.

  • Appium: Open-source tool for automating mobile app testing across iOS and Android.
  • Espresso: Google’s Android-specific test automation framework.
  • XCTest: Apple’s native framework for testing iOS applications.

7. Containerization Tools

Containers package an application and its dependencies together, ensuring consistent environments across development and production.

  • Docker: The most popular containerization platform.
  • Kubernetes: For orchestrating and managing containerized applications at scale.

8. Security Tools

Security needs to be integrated into every phase of the DevOps lifecycle, known as DevSecOps.

  • SonarQube: Continuous code inspection for security vulnerabilities.
  • OWASP ZAP: Open-source security scanner.
  • Snyk: Monitors dependencies for vulnerabilities and suggests fixes.

9. Mobile Backend as a Service (MBaaS)

MBaaS platforms provide ready-to-use back-end services like authentication, database, cloud storage, etc.

  • Firebase: Popular for real-time databases and easy integration with mobile apps.
  • AWS Amplify: Offers authentication, APIs, and storage for mobile developers.
  • Back4App: An open-source backend-as-a-service platform.

10. Deployment and App Distribution

Deploying apps efficiently for testing and production is critical.

  • Fastlane: Automates beta deployments and app store releases.
  • Microsoft App Center: Continuous integration, testing, and deployment platform.
  • TestFlight: Apple’s official platform for distributing iOS beta apps.

Challenges in Implementing DevOps for Mobile Apps

While DevOps offers numerous benefits, mobile development presents unique challenges:

  • Device fragmentation: Testing on a wide range of devices is complex.
  • App store approval delays: Unlike web apps, mobile apps must go through rigorous review processes.
  • Network variability: Mobile apps must perform well under different network conditions.

Best Practices for Integrating DevOps in Mobile Development

  1. Automate Everything: From builds to testing and deployment.
  2. Start with Continuous Integration: Make small, frequent code updates.
  3. Prioritize Monitoring and Analytics: Monitor app performance and user behavior.
  4. Integrate Security Early: Shift left on security practices.
  5. Collaborate Across Teams: Use tools like Slack and Jira for seamless communication.
  6. Optimize for App Stores: Plan releases according to app store approval timelines.
